I thought the only advantage of E85 was the ability to crank the boost, and not much to be gained for a normally aspirated engine.
Is that right?
|
Ability to "crank the boost" on E85 comes from two things. First, it's a higher octane rating them regular pump (around 105 octane). Second, ethanol burns cooler, so lower cylinder temps.
There is gains to be had an a NA engine. On a NA 250, no, probably not much. But I ran E85 (with increased timing) on my NA ZX12R and it did provide gains.
Of course all depends on your combo, compression ratio, ability to adjust timing, etc
